Solucionat: Mostra els drets d'autor de l'any

El principal problema de mostrar l'any dels drets d'autor als mitjans digitals és que pot ser difícil determinar quins anys estan coberts pels drets d'autor. Això pot ser un problema quan s'intenta determinar si un mitjà concret encara està protegit pels drets d'autor o no.

var d = new Date();
var n = d.getFullYear();
document.getElementById("year").innerHTML = n;

Aquest codi crea un nou objecte de data, després obté l'any complet a partir d'aquest objecte de data i l'emmagatzema a la variable n. Finalment, troba l'element amb id="year" i canvia el seu innerHTML al valor de n.

Cerca

A JavaScript, podeu utilitzar la funció search() per cercar una cadena en un buffer de text o de cadena. La funció search() pren dos arguments: el text a cercar i la cadena a cercar.

La funció search() retorna un objecte amb dues propietats: el text trobat i la posició del text trobat a la memòria intermèdia de text o de cadena. La propietat de text trobat conté la cadena coincident, mentre que la propietat de posició us indica on s'ha trobat la cadena coincident al text o al buffer de cadenes.

Aquí teniu un exemple que utilitza la funció search() per trobar totes les instàncies de "cat" en un fitxer de text:

var fitxer = "./myfile.txt"; // obre el fitxer per llegir var contents = file.search(“cat”); // obteniu un objecte que conté // foundText i posició console.log(contents); // imprimeix "No hi ha resultats".

Mètodes

Hi ha molts mètodes en JavaScript. Alguns dels mètodes més comuns s'enumeren a continuació.

Mètode Descripció alert() Mostra un missatge a la pantalla. bind() Enllaça una funció a un esdeveniment particular. call() Crida una funció. clear() Esborra la pantalla. console.log() Imprimeix informació a la consola. document.getElementById(id) Recupera un element pel seu atribut id. exit() Finalitza l'execució de l'script i torna a la finestra principal del navegador. forEach() Repeteix un bloc de codi per a cada element d'una matriu o col·lecció. if(condició) Avalua una condició i, si és cert, executa el codi contingut al bloc; en cas contrari, executa un altre bloc de codi. keydown(esdeveniment) Activa un esdeveniment quan es prem una tecla al teclat. data lastModified Retorna o estableix la data i l'hora en què aquest document es va modificar per darrera vegada (en mil·lisegons). length Retorna la longitud d'un objecte (en bytes). Math.floor(nombre) Arrodoneix el nombre al valor enter més proper. Matemàtiques. ceil(nombre) Arrodoneix el nombre al valor enter més proper. new Date () Crea un nou objecte Date utilitzant la data i l'hora actuals com a paràmetres (en mil·lisegons). Object clone() Crea i retorna una còpia d'un object obj . prototype Permet accedir a propietats i mètodes de la cadena de prototips d'un objecte (és a dir, objectes que es deriven d'aquest objecte). pushStackTrace(stackTrace) Afegeix informació de traça de la pila a un missatge d'error que mostra la consola . setTimeout(time, [callback]) Estableix un temps d'espera per a l'execució del codi després d'haver transcorregut una quantitat determinada de mil·lisegons; si es proporciona una devolució de trucada, s'executarà un cop caduqui el temps d'espera setInterval(time, [callback]) Estableix un interval per a l'execució del codi després d'haver transcorregut una quantitat determinada de mil·lisegons; si es proporciona una devolució de trucada, s'executarà cada cop que caduqui l'interval

Articles Relacionats:

Deixa el teu comentari